LSI Architects sets new standards with Design Excellence Award

South Norfolk Council's Design Awards judges announced today that they were ‘stunned’ by the quality of the new Wymondham College sixth form centre in Norfolk, designed by London and Norwich based LSI Architects. So stunned were the judges by the College design, that at this year's eighth annual awards – Friday, November 14 - they broke with tradition and created a new, special Award for ‘Design Excellence’. Now they are calling on developers across the board to improve the quality of design in their own more general development proposals. The aim of the annual South Norfolk Design Awards is to promote good design and to show how this can improve the quality of the built environment and its landscape setting.

In addition to the 2008 Award for ‘Design Excellence’, the scheme also secured the Award for ‘New Building’ and the Award for ‘Landscape’.

The new, £6.75 million expansion scheme which provides new, sixth form boarding facilities at Wymondham College provide a ‘wishbone’ style extension to an existing boarding block, with 115 new ensuite single study bedrooms and support accommodation, library, IT rooms, new communal activity spaces and an expansion of the existing dining facilities. The new building links to the existing Lincoln Hall building to provide a single base for all Year 12 and Year 13 pupils. Wymondham College is both the UK’s largest State Boarding School and one of the few State Boarding schools in the country, classified by the DfES as a ‘Successful and Popular’ School.

In the judging panel's view of the design of Wyndham College’s new sixth form centre: "The resulting solution is a distinctive and dramatic building with two wings meeting in a westward pointing ‘prow’ which is clearly visible on entry into the site. This prominent end to the building is facetted and glazed giving it a strong three-dimensional quality and is the point at which the three storey southern wing meets the four-storey northern wing. There are clear visual links between the design of the building and its landscape setting, which create a strong character and sense of place within the courtyard. The straight and curved wings define a courtyard of asymmetrical shape and provide a sense of enclosure to a space which offers possibilities for a variety of activities."

The judges were also highly impressed by the building's sustainability credentials using renewable energy technologies.

The design of new Sixth Form complex at the College was won by LSI Architects in a limited competition in 2005 and the Governors awarded the contract to local contractors, RG Carter and structural design engineers, Ramboll Whitbybird.

The main concept behind the design for the new complex was to provide all residents with a view outwards over the Norfolk countryside, from rooms organised in three and four-storey wings arranged around a large, landscaped courtyard. Access to the new wings is via a covered walkway surrounding the new courtyard. The wings meet in a dramatic westward pointing ‘prow', which is clearly visible on entry into the campus.

As time was an important factor to the project, the bathroom ‘pods’ were pre-fabricated to make construction quicker. As every student knows – noise travels fast in close-knit dorms so to minimise this problem the structures team used a reinforced concrete frame construction with alternating loadbearing crosswalls.

LSI Project Associate, Jeremy O’Rourke, said: “The new building makes a bold, contemporary architectural statement, with large areas of white render, timber cladding and glazing. The idea is that the new building provides high quality accommodation akin to that which the student may experience at University. To this end, the design concept allows each new room to enjoy distant views, whilst making a diverse range of activities possible within the landscaped courtyard at the heart of the scheme. Here there is a stage for performance, places for outdoor lessons and areas for the display of students’ art.”

Mr O’Rourke concluded: “The sustainability agenda has been a key determinant of the design. The highly insulated building has exposed concrete surfaces internally to provide cooling in the summer, has hot water produced by solar panels, and is largely ventilated by natural means.”
